What themes are explored in the poem 'Hasty and Eager' by Xuân Diệu?

The poem 'Hasty and Eager' explores themes of intense love for life and nature, as well as the desire to capture fleeting beauty. Xuân Diệu conveys a yearning to extinguish the sun and restrain the wind, which symbolize the poet's passionate longing to preserve the vibrancy and essence of life.
2.

How does Xuân Diệu's imagery enhance the understanding of his desires in the poem?

Xuân Diệu's use of vivid imagery, such as bees and butterflies, flowers turning green, and melodious sounds, deepens the reader's understanding of his desires. These images evoke a lush, vibrant paradise that reflects his intense feelings, making the abstract longings more tangible and relatable.
3.

What poetic techniques does Xuân Diệu use in the opening lines of 'Hasty and Eager'?

In the opening lines of 'Hasty and Eager,' Xuân Diệu employs repetition, specifically the phrase 'I want,' to emphasize his deep desires. Additionally, he utilizes metaphor and simile, such as comparing January to 'a pair of close lips,' to create a sensory connection between nature and human emotions, enriching the poem's emotional impact.
4.

What is the significance of the phrase 'January tastes as sweet as a pair of close lips'?

The phrase 'January tastes as sweet as a pair of close lips' signifies a unique connection between the beauty of nature and sensuality. Xuân Diệu portrays nature as something alive and full of emotions, suggesting that the sweetness of January embodies a loving, intimate relationship, thus elevating the experience of the season.

How does the poem 'Hasty and Eager' reflect Xuân Diệu's artistic style?

The poem 'Hasty and Eager' reflects Xuân Diệu's artistic style through its vibrant imagery and emotional depth. His characteristic use of fresh metaphors and a passionate tone captures the essence of life, showcasing his unique perspective as a leading figure in modern Vietnamese poetry, often emphasizing themes of love and nature.
